We have a hot water solar panel on the roof. A couple of days ago the pump was making a sqeeching noise and I thought the pump was broken. I disconnected the pump and planned to look for a new one but also wanted to check the function and removed it. On the bench the pump worked fine and I refitted it, but despite the panel showing a higher temperature than the hot water cylinder the water was not getting any warmer. Even though there was a dribble of liquid coming out of the pipe I think the system has run dry and needs refilling / recharging.
How best can I refill the system???
When it was fitted the company put a T with an isolation valve under the garage roof. The T has a 15mm connection.
The solar panel is on the same level as the hot water cylinder.
Has anyone refilled their solar panel using a pump?
Are there any DIY / pumps available for this kind of job?
